Dal Bukhara is a creamy, slow-cooked lentil dish infused with smoky tandoor flavor from charcoal and ghee. It's rich, warming, and traditionally served with naan or rice.

Ingredients

serves 6
  • 1⅓ cup Whole Urad ((also known as black matpe or black gram beans))
  • 4 cups Water
  • 2 Plum Tomatoes (pureed or 1 cup tomato puree)
  • 2 teaspoons Ginger Paste
  • 2 teaspoons Garlic Paste
  • 1 teaspoon Kashmiri Red Chili Powder
  • 3 teaspoons Kosher Salt
  • 2 tablespoons Butter
  • ⅓ cup Cream
  • ½ teaspoon Garam Masala (optional )
  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• 1 piece of charcoal
  • ¼ teaspoon ghee
